**Troubleshooting: GraphQL N+1 on the Ordersheet resolver**

For the weekly eng sync: the `lineItems` field in Marrowlane's Ordersheet API was issuing one database query per parent order, causing 400ms+ latencies on large accounts. The fix introduces a batching dataloader keyed on order ID, collapsing the calls into a single IN-clause query. Verify the fix by querying fifty orders on staging and confirming one SQL statement in the trace. Authenticate the test query with the token below.

login token, bagug-kafop: eyJhbGciOiJIUzI1NiIsInR5cCI6IkpXVCJ9.eyJzdWIiOiIcMLov2In0.Z5RLDIfp

## Deploying the Gatewick Proctor Queue

Deploys are pretty painless: push to main, wait for the pipeline, then watch the queue drain dashboard for five minutes. If candidates pile up mid-exam, roll back first and ask questions later — the queue replays safely. Everything the workers care about lives in one config block, shown here for reference.

settings of bafof-yagef:
JOROX_PIN=8740
JOROX_TENANT=pelox
JOROX_METRICS_HOST=metrics.jorox.qorvelworks.internal
JOROX_SEAL=seal_c78f63c1
JOROX_STANDBY_TEAM=norax

**FAQ: How does pagination work in the Larkfeed public REST API?**

Short version: cursor-based, not offset-based. Each list response includes a `next_cursor`; pass it back to get the next page. Cursors are opaque and expire after 15 minutes, so don't cache them. Page size caps at 100 — yes, partners ask for more, and no, we don't bump it. If you ever need to regenerate the cursor-signing secret after an incident, the vault that holds it unlocks with the passphrase below.

vault phrase of tajef-tafog = istox-sorax-zorox-casok-holox-kelix-weneth-drueth-casion